  • Cindy Cindy on Sep 05, 2018

    I like the "barn door" look. But there is some carpentry involved. Another choice would be to just convert the bi-fold doors you have. You could remove the slats and put mirror there instead. Or maybe a new paint color would help. Make sure to do something you like. Have fun with this project.

  • Within the Grove Within the Grove on Sep 13, 2018

    We found that getting a new door for our pantry wasn't an option. We would need a custom size or create a barn door. Both of which were not in our budget. Instead, we took apart the bi-fold doors and made them open like french doors and gave them a complete makeover.
